#4c4f2d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#4c4f2d is composed of 29.8% red, 31% green and 17.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 3.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 43% yellow and 69% black. It has a hue angle of 65.3 degrees, a saturation of 27.4% and a lightness of 24.3%. #4c4f2d color hex could be obtained by blending #989e5a with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336633.

Shades and Tints of #4c4f2d

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040402 is the darkest color, while #fafaf7 is the lightest one.

Tones of #4c4f2d

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#40413b is the less saturated color, while #6f7a02 is the most saturated one.
